
TIERRA AZUL | HARBOR BAR
West Harbor, San Pedro, CA
Tierra Azul Harbor Bar is envisioned as a vibrant open-air hospitality pavilion at the heart of West Harbor’s Central Park in San Pedro. Positioned directly along the waterfront promenade, the project transforms a compact site into a highly visible social destination—connecting the energy of West Harbor’s restaurants, retail, landscaped public spaces, and harbor edge. The design is intentionally open and porous, allowing views, pedestrian activity, and the coastal atmosphere to become part of the experience.
At the center of the project is an efficient service pavilion surrounded by guest-facing bar seating, outdoor lounges, and lush landscape. A wraparound bar creates an active edge on multiple sides while the more functional back-of-house components are consolidated and screened, allowing the majority of the site to remain dedicated to guests. Layered planting, low transparent barriers, and a variety of seating zones define intimate spaces without disconnecting the bar from the surrounding promenade or waterfront.
Architecturally, Tierra Azul combines the relaxed character of Southern California waterfront living with a more refined, contemporary hospitality experience. Warm natural materials, deep overhangs, integrated lighting, distinctive signage, and landscape create a pavilion that transitions easily from a casual daytime gathering place to an atmospheric evening destination. Conceived as both a destination in itself and an extension of West Harbor’s public realm, Tierra Azul is designed to become a lively social anchor along the San Pedro waterfront.
